Joshua Stephen Spears is a 34 years old. His residential address is 605 Lesser, Success, AR 72470.
Age 24
Age 64
Age 85
Age 71
Joshua Stephen Spears is 34 . He was born on Sep 30, 1990.
Joshua Stephen Spears’s address is listed as 605 Lesser, Success , AR 72470, US.